This sentence contains two clauses - an independent clause (We moved) and a dependent/subordinate clause (because our house was too small). Given that the second sentence gives us a reason why they moved, it acts as an adverb, which is why it is an adverbial clause.

<span>Thesis statement is not merely a topic. It is the main idea of a writing assignment that often reflects the writer's opinion about the topic based on personal experience or personal reading. From the thesis statement, supporting sentences will be given to prove said statement to be true.
